Le Freeport, formerly known as Singapore Freeport, is a high-security storage and display facility in Singapore.[1] A majority stake is held by Natural Le Coultre S.A. of art dealer and shipper Yves Bouvier.[2] Opened near Singapore Changi Airport in May 2010, the facility is modelled after similar institutions in Geneva and Luxembourg.[3][4] The Freeport was on sale, but has since been purchased.[5]
